  • Recently, unstructured data is rapidly being produced based on web-based services. NoSQL systems and key value stores that process unstructured data as key and value pairs are widely used in various applications. In this paper, a study was conducted on a skip list used for in-memory data management in an LSM-tree based key value store. The skip list used in the key value store is an insertion-based skip list that does not allow overwriting and processes all changes only by inserting. This behavior can support Multi-Version Concurrency Control (MVCC), which can simultaneously process multiple read/write requests through snapshot isolation. However, since duplicate keys exist in the skip list, the performance significantly degrades due to unnecessary node visits during a list traverse. In particular, serious overhead occurs when a range query or scan operation that collectively searches a specific range of data occurs. This paper proposes a newly designed Stride SkipList to reduce this overhead. The stride skip list additionally maintains an indexing pointer for the last node of the same key to avoid unnecessary node visits. The proposed scheme is implemented using RocksDB's in-memory component, and the performance evaluation shows that the performance of SCAN operation improves by up to 350 times compared to the existing skip list for various workloads.

  • Objectives: This study examined the effects of nutrition education focused on personalized daily energy requirement and food units using Food Exchange System on anthropometric, biochemical characteristics, nutrition knowledge, dietary attitude and nutrient intakes for overweight and obese in a public health center. Methods: The subjects were 60 overweight/obese women based on BMI (educated 30 vs. non-educated 30, 50~64 years). Educated group was provided individual and/or group lessons (40 min/lesson/week, 5 week), 'Introduction: obese & health', '6 nutrients and 6 food groups', 'My obesity & daily needed energy', 'Meal planning for personalized daily energy and food units using Food Exchange Systems', and 'Smart food choices'. After education, we examined the differences in anthropometric/biochemical characteristics, nutrition knowledge, dietary attitude and nutrient intakes between educated group and non-educated group. Results: After nutrition education, in the educated group, there were improvements on anthropometric/biochemical characteristics, nutrition knowledge, dietary attitude and nutrient intakes in the educated group compared to the non-educated group. We observed a decrease in the mean weight, total cholesterol (TC) and the incidence of overweight/obesity and hypercholesterolemia and an increase in the mean lean body mass. The scores of nutrition knowledge, 'Function of carbohydrate, protein, vitamin, mineral' and 'Food Sources of fat, vitamin, mineral' were increased. The scores of dietary attitudes, 'Taking a joyful meal, a leisurely meal, a balanced meal, a meal with sufficient vegetables, a meal with diversity, a meal with spicy foods, a meal with overeating' were increased. The intakes of energy, carbohydrate, fat, protein, vitamin A, thiamin, Zn and cholesterol were decreased. The scores of INQ, protein, vitamin A, vitamin C, thiamin, riboflavin, vitamin B6, folate, Ca, P, Fe, Zn were increased. Conclusions: The nutrition education focused on personalized daily energy requirement and food exchange unit using Food Exchange System for overweight and obese may improve food behavior, dietary intakes and symptoms of overweight and obese, even in a community health center.

  • This paper proposes a prepaid system promotion policy for the 3G(WCDMA) MVNO with regard to the newly included paragraphs 3, 4 and 5 of Article 32 (User Protection) and Article 38 (Provision of Wholesale Telecommunications Services) of the Telecommunication Business Act, which was revised on March 22, 2010. As of June 2011, there are only a few prepaid system subscribers to the mobile communications service due to various limitations, including prepay, interconnection, carrier selection, the MVNO policy, and number portability. However, overseas communications service regulatory agencies and service providers are increasingly presenting policies and strategies for mobile prepaid plans, in order to accommodate the various customer demands that are increasing the use of smart phones and data. This paper advances various proposals concerning promotion of the prepaid system by the 3G MVNO under the current Telecommunication Business Act, including separation of the prepaid data system and the mobile network; introduction of a monthly fixed-rate hybrid prepaid system, a top-up system and USIM system; introduction of mobile network carrier selection; differentiated retail discounts between prepaid and post-paid prices; revision of the retail discount policy for wholesale provision; increase in the number of mandatory service providers; and in-depth consideration of the introduction of a number portability policy for the prepaid and post-paid systems.

  • Twitter, Facebook, and KakaoStory are the major SNS in Korea. Social knowledge production is being produced by those services from numerous collaboration and co-participation in those SNS. Wikipedia or Naver JishikIN service was regarded as the representative product of collective knowledge production during the wired internet era. However now at the wireless internet era centered with smart phones, various forms of collective knowledge production would be achieved by connecting to SNS in real-time. In this thesis, the survey data of collective knowledge production for users of three SNS have been compared and analyzed. The difference of the collective knowledge production mechanism among Twitter, Facebook and KakaoStory has been studied and compared through three variables: the motivation of collective knowledge production, the preference of collective knowledge production model, and collective knowledge production cultural perception. As a result of the analysis of the discriminant factors for three SNS user groups, it turns out that the diversity-toward usage motivation, personal contribution motivation, and collective knowledge production tendency perception are the most influential variables. This thesis is of significance in that it unites the value of social science such as social capital and collective knowledge production from the viewpoint of computer science and opens the new chapter of collective knowledge production with the real-time SNS of wireless internet from the wired internet.

  • With the emergence of the IoT environment, various smart devices provide consumers with the convenience and various services. However, as security threats such as invasion of privacy have been reported, the importance of security issues in the IoT environment has emerged, and in particular, the security problem of key management has been discussed, and the PUF has been discussed as a countermeasure. In relation to the key management problem, a protocol using MIPUF has been proposed for the security problem of the group key management system. The system can be applied to lightweight IoT environments and the safety of the PUF ensures the safety of the entire system. However, in some processes, it shows vulnerabilities in terms of safety and efficiency of operation. This paper improves the existing protocol by adding authentication for members, ensuring data independence, reducing unnecessary operations, and increasing the efficiency of database searches. Safety analysis is performed for a specific attack and efficiency analysis results are presented by comparing the computational quantities. Through this, this paper shows that the reliability of data can be improved and our proposed method is lighter than existing protocol.

  • Due to the advantages of fast read/write operation and low power consumption, SSD(Solid State Drive) is now widely adopted as storage device of smart phone, laptop computer, server, etc. However, the shortcomings of SSD such as limited number of write operations and asymmetric read/write operation lead to the problem of shortened life span of SSD. Therefore, the block replacement policy of SSD used as cache for HDD is very important. The existing solutions for improving the lifespan of SSD including the LARC scheme typically employ the LRU algorithm to manage the SSD blocks, which may increase the miss rate in SSD due to the replacement of frequently used block instead of rarely used block. In this paper we propose a novel block replacement scheme which considers the block reuse interval to effectively handle various data read/write patterns. The proposed scheme replaces the block in SSD based on the recency decided by reuse interval and age along with hit ratio. Computer simulation using workload trace files reveals that the proposed scheme consistently improves the performance and lifespan of SSD by increasing the hit ratio and decreasing the number of write operations compared to the existing schemes including LARC.

  • HTML5 has developed not to have browser dependancy considering interoperability as same as maintaining compatability with lower versions of HTML. HTML5, the newest web standardization is on going of being structured. Along with the smart phone boom, HTML5 is spotlighted because it can be applied to cross platforms in mobile web environments. Specially the local Storage that has been listed in new features in HTML5 supports offline function for web application that enables web application to be run even when the mobile is not connected to 3G or wifi. With Local storage, development of server-independent web application can be possible. However Local storage stores plaintext data in it without applying any security measure and this makes the plaintext data dangerous to security threats that are already exist in other client side storages like Cookie. In the paper we propose secure Local storage methods to offer a safe way to store and retrieve data in Local storage guaranteeing its performance. Suggested functions in this paper follow localStorage standard API and use a module that provide cryptographic function. We also prove the efficiency of suggested secure Local storage based on its performance evaluation with implementation.
